A mighty evening ahead with Electric Wizard & Friends
- News
Electric Wizard have announced three support acts for their upcoming headline London show, set to take place at the Roundhouse in Camden on Friday, 15th May.
Opening proceedings will be Moss, who describe their sound as “Horror Music”, followed by psych sensations, Purson, then Glaswegian five- piece, The Cosmic Dead, will bring an element of space rock to proceedings before the mighty Electric Wizard arrive.
This is a very special one-off event and follows in the wake of Electric Wizard's most successful album release to date, ‘Time to Die’ – the eighth full-length record from the band and their first to be released via Spinefarm Records.
Prior to the Roundhouse show, the band will release a new single; titled ‘Lucifer’s Slaves’ from the album.

Wire - DRILL : LEXINGTON supports revealed
- News
After recently announcing news of their new self-titled album, due 13th April via pinkflag, Wire have shared a new track ‘Split Your Ends’ from the album and have also confirmed the other acts taking part in their residency at The Lexington next month.
The self titled album WIRE will be launched by the fourth event in the band's DRILL series entitled DRILL : LEXINGTON - five nights (14-18 April) at the Lexington in London with Wire headlining, plus a different curated support each night. This will be followed by a UK tour.

The Warlocks - UK Tour
- News
The Warlocks fly in from L.A. this May for a sonic blast of Skull Worship and the rest of their back catalogue.
The band have just signed a three album deal with Cleopatra Records and after their UK tour in May and US tour in June the band will be back in the studio to work on new material.

Luna return for London show At The Garage
- News
Some great news is that Luna will be playing their first UK show in 10 years at The Garage in London on Friday, 31st July.
The group comprising of Dean Wareham, Britta Phillips, Sean Eden and Lee Wall announced their reunion late last year, and play their comeback show in Los Angeles on 13th April.
